Your new role

As an IT Senior Developer, you will design, develop, and implement software solutions to solve complex business challenges. You’ll work on platforms such as ServiceNow, collaborate with cross-functional teams, and ensure high-quality, scalable applications. This is a hybrid position with designated in-office days, subject to change based on business needs.
Key responsibilities include:
  • Designing and maintaining software applications (e.g., ServiceNow).
  • Gathering requirements and translating them into technical solutions.
  • Writing clean, efficient code and conducting code reviews.
  • Troubleshooting and resolving software issues.
  • Mentoring junior developers and staying current with industry trends.

What you'll need to succeed

  •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science or equivalent.
  • 5+ years as a System Administrator/Developer and 5–7 years in IT Service Delivery.
  • 3+ years of coding/scripting experience (JavaScript, CSS, HTML, AngularJS).
  • Strong knowledge of ServiceNow platform and architecture.
  • Experience with web frameworks (Angular, React, ASP.NET) and databases (SQL Server, Oracle).
  • Familiarity with LDAP/Active Directory and Cloud Architecture.
  • Excellent problem-solving, communication, and teamwork skills.
  • CSA (Certified System Administrator) or CAD (Certified Application Developer) certifications
